Da Silva to stay with Sparta ^top Sparta Rotterdam starlet David Mendes da Silva looks set to snub Newcastle and sign a one-year extension with the Dutch club. The 18-year-old defender, who has been tracked by Bobby Robson, made the decision to stay because of the arrival of former Dutch national team coach Frank Rijkaard. He said: "The coming of Rijkaard as new coach at Sparta made me decide to stay for one more year. "This is really a dream come true to me, while before that I really did not believe in a longer stay at Sparta at all. "Coach Willem van Hanegem left, Ali Elhattabi was gone and there were no reinforcements coming." Da Silva, who has been dubbed "the new Frank Rijkaard", had attracted attention from both Newcastle and Ajax, and it was believed that the youngster was on his way to St James' Park. The teenager said: "Newcastle and Sparta had already agreed a deal, and in my heart I already had chosen to join Newcastle." But he has now decided to extend his Sparta contract and is looking to play a part in the club's revival under Rijkaard.
